Ingredients (Makes 4 sandwiches):
For the Sloppy Joe Filling:
- 1 lb (450g) ground beef (or ground turkey for lighter version)
- 1 small onion , finely chopped (or shallots for milder sweetness)
- ½ bell pepper , diced (optional – or mushrooms for meatier texture)
- 1 cup tomato sauce (or crushed tomatoes + 1 tsp sugar)
- 2 tbsp ketchup (or chili sauce for variation)
- 1 tbsp Worcestershire sauce (or soy sauce for vegan option)
- 1 tbsp mustard (yellow or Dijon – adds tang)
- 1 tbsp brown sugar (or maple syrup for vegan option)
- 1 tsp garlic powder (or 2 cloves fresh garlic)
- ½ tsp onion powder (or extra onion for moisture)
- Salt and black pepper , to taste
For the Grilled Cheese:
- 8 slices bread (sourdough, white, or whole wheat – use thick slices for best structure)
- 8 slices cheddar or American cheese (or mozzarella for stretchy melt)
- 2–3 tbsp butter , softened (or mayonnaise-coated bread for crispy hack)
Instructions:
Step 1: Brown the Beef
In a skillet over medium heat , cook ground beef until browned (6–8 minutes ), breaking it up with a spatula as it cooks.
Drain excess fat if needed.
Step 2: Sauté the Veggies
Add chopped onion and bell pepper to the pan.
Cook for 3–4 minutes , stirring occasionally until soft and fragrant.
Step 3: Build the Sloppy Sauce
Stir in:
- Tomato sauce, ketchup, Worcestershire, mustard
- Brown sugar, garlic powder, onion powder, salt, and pepper
Simmer uncovered for 10–15 minutes , stirring occasionally, until sauce reduces and clings to the meat.
Tip: Taste and adjust seasoning—add more spice or sweetness as desired.
Step 4: Prep the Bread & Cheese
Butter one side of each bread slice—this ensures a golden, crispy crust.
Place cheese slices on half of the unbuttered sides.
Step 5: Assemble Like a Pro
On four bread slices (buttered side down), place:
- A generous scoop of Sloppy Joe mixture
- Another slice of cheese on top
Top with the remaining bread, buttered side up .
Step 6: Grill Until Golden
Heat a clean skillet over medium heat .
Place sandwiches in the pan and press gently with a spatula.
Grill 3–4 minutes per side , or until golden and crisp.
Cheese should be fully melted inside.
Step 7: Slice & Serve Gooey
Transfer to a cutting board and let rest for 1 minute before slicing in half.

Tips for Success:
- 🧈 Use Cold Hands: Helps shape and press without sticking.
- 🥣 Don’t Overcook Beef: Simmering too long can dry out the mixture—keep it saucy.
- 🥟 Bread Hack: Use thick-cut bread—it holds up better to the wet filling.
- 🧁 Cheese Swap Magic: Try pepper jack, Gouda, or vegan cheese for different finishes.
- ❄️ Make Ahead Magic: Make filling ahead and refrigerate—grill sandwiches fresh when ready.
